As humans we seek different forms of communication. We need it to coexist and to satisfy our very basic needs. We are extremely complex beings living together in an ever more complex environment that creates barriers and sets standards to the purest forms of communication within each other; sometimes preventing us to interact naturally. How sad to think that we are so much more than what our surroundings are allowing us to be.

Sight, hearing, taste and smell are all part of our interaction with our environment and therefore a form of communication. Let´s not forget touch as a form of communication too. There might be a little restriction with this one, because we are set to believe and feel that there is something wrong with it. It seems like a taboo was created for the natural behavior of touching each other. We even dare to feel uncomfortable by the gentle touch of someone else. There is a lot to consider when it gets to the nonverbal form of communication as it is complex, it could be simple if we allow it to be. As natural as it is, boundaries will fall naturally and then real and pure communication will emerge.

As simple as it sounds, there is much greatness and power in a simple touch, a stroke, a short hug or a subtle pat on the shoulder. We will always need it to exist, to belong, show acceptance, love and recognition with one another. Touch is the symbol of proximity with one another. Feeling and acknowledging another person manifested in a reciprocal action of giving and receiving, an action of pure humanity in which we assume it spiritually and physically.

Today more than ever, we need to look around us and notice the people around, the ones close to us and the ones with whom we share a short encounter. Do not forget that the minimum manifestation of affection can be the difference between life and death, loneliness and the sense of belonging, or the merely recognition of existence.

Never be afraid of a gentle touch, of giving or receiving it. Give a little of you and accept what is given to you. There will always be a marvel in your touch.
